Responsibilities

  • Lead and support planning for major fundraising events and donor experiences.
  • Collaborate with internal teams, vendors and volunteers to manage event logistics, timelines and execution.
  • Process payments and monitor financials with accuracy and timeliness.
  • Provide on-site support for events across the region, including occasional travel.
  • Contribute to a high-performing team culture focused on excellence, innovation and mission impact.
  • Plan and execute a variety of mission-driven events and meetings.
  • Source and manage vendors, venues, catering, AV and entertainment, ensuring cost-effective solutions and compliance with the Association guidelines.
  • Implement risk reduction procedures to ensure safe and successful events.
  • Recruit, train, and schedule volunteers to support event execution.
  • Serve as the on-site lead for setup, execution, and teardown.
  • Act as the primary contact for vendors, sponsors, volunteers, and attendees, delivering exceptional service.
  • Create ADA-compliant digital communications (invitations, programs, logistics) in coordination with marketing teams using Association templates and branding.
  • Support virtual event production, including multimedia coordination and technical support.
  • Maintain accurate and organized event data, including guest lists, sponsorships, seating, and donor benefits.
  • Manage auction item data and associated revenue/donations with precision and compliance.
  • Track and analyze donation and revenue data, correcting discrepancies and generating reports as needed.
  • Collaborate with fundraising teams to review revenue, accounts receivable/payable and ensure financial accuracy.
  • Research discrepancies and assist with resolving past-due amounts.
  • Process vendor payments and contracts in the financial system.
  • Monitor event budgets and ensure cost-effective planning.
  • Adhere to the Association’s Funds Handling and PCI procedures for all financial transactions.
